Big Girl Panties is a peppy and cheerful resource for motivating toddlers to become potty-trained.
A pigtailed child in red ribbons and underwear hops and skips her way through these pages, proudly proclaiming, “Bye-bye, diapers! I wear panties! Happy panties! Snappy panties!” She shows off a wide range of underwear choices, from “panties with rainbows and ducks in a line” to “princess panties that sparkle and shine.”
She gleefully informs her baby brother and stuffed monkey that they can’t wear panties because only BIG girls get to do that, just like mommies, aunties, and grandmas. On the last page, she asks the readers if they wear panties too, and informs them that, well, then they must be big girls, too.
This cute board book will make a potty-training toddler girl feel very proud of herself and especially motivated to join the “big girls.” I also liked the bright, cheerful and comical illustrations by Valeria Petrone, which add just the right touch of cuteness to the book without being at all coy or cloying.
